Colour transient improvement circuit
TDA4566
GENERAL DESCRIPTION
The TDA4566 is a monolithic integrated circuit for colour-transient improvement (CTI) and luminance delay line in gyrator
technique in colour television receivers.
Features
• Colour transient improvement for colour difference signals (R-Y) and (B-Y) with transient detecting-, storage- and
switching stages resulting in high transients of colour difference output signals
• A luminance signal path (Y) which substitutes the conventional Y-delay coil with an integrated Y-delay line
• Switchable delay time from 550 ns to 820 ns in steps of 90 ns and additional fine adjustment of 37 ns
• Two Y output signals; one of 180 ns less delay
QUICK REFERENCE DATA
Note
1. Delay time is proportional to resistor R14-18.
R14-18 also influences the bandwidth; a value of 1.2 kΩ results in a bandwidth of 5 MHz (typ.).
PACKAGE OUTLINE
18-lead DIL; plastic (SOT102); SOT102-1; 1996 November 27.
